Web26 de nov. de 2024 · Kalaloch Campground is one of the largest campgrounds in Olympic National Park, located on the South Coast with immediate shoreline access. It has 170 sites, many with ocean views. Most of the campsites at Kalaloch can be reserved ahead of time, leaving very few for walk-in availability.

Edit philhealth muntinlupa addressWebSeal Rock Campground This popular campground with its beautiful views of Hood Canal and the mountains to the southeast is located directly on Hood Canal.
